On Fri, Jun 9, 2023 at 5:42 PM Gregory Smith <gregsmithpgsql(at)gmail(dot)com> wrote:
>
> On Fri, Jun 9, 2023 at 1:25 PM Gurjeet Singh <gurjeet(at)singh(dot)im> wrote:
>>
>> > $ pgbench -i -I dtGvp -s 500
>>
>> The steps are severely under-documented in pgbench --help output.
>
>
> I agree it's not easy to find information. I just went through double checking I had the order recently enough to remember what I did. The man pages have this:
>
> > Each step is invoked in the specified order. The default is dtgvp.
>
> Which was what I wanted to read. Meanwhile the --help output says:
>
> > -I, --init-steps=[dtgGvpf]+ (default "dtgvp")
>
> %T$%%Which has the information without a lot of context for what it's used for. I'd welcome some text expansion that added a minimal but functional improvement to that the existing help output; I don't have such text.
Please see attached 2 variants of the patch. Variant 1 simply tells
the reader to consult pgbench documentation. The second variant
provides a description for each of the letters, as the documentation
does. The committer can pick the one they find suitable.
